Carey Watermark Investors 2 Incorporated Announces Acquisition of San Diego Marriott

San Diego Marriott La Jolla (credit Mariott)

Carey Watermark Investors 2 Incorporated (CWI 2), a non-traded real estate investment trust (REIT), has announced its acquisition of the San Diego Marriott in La Jolla, California. The renovated asset, updated three years ago, is located within the Golden Triangle just north of downtown San Diego and minutes from La Jolla and the Pacific Ocean. The 14-story building has 372 guestrooms and 24,000 square feet of meeting and event space.

The hotel’s strategic location places guests within convenient reach of popular leisure attractions, leading corporations and professional firms, and top research institutions, such as the University of California at San Diego. Located in the University Towne Centre (UTC) development, the hotel is surrounded by over four million square feet of Class A office space and enjoys direct access via a sky bridge to the upscale Westfield UTC mall anchored by tenants including Nordstrom and Macy’s.

Carey Watermark Investors 2 is focused on investing in lodging and lodging-related properties. The San Diego Marriott joins other recent acquisitions – the San Jose Marriott and the Le Meridien Arlington – as part of the REIT’s growing portfolio. According to its website, it is still a blind pool offering, has not generated any net income, and has a limited operating history.
